Output d53ffcb6b461f59892c60c23afdc62516116fa0626eae377ceba910ac326f47b:0

value
577915
script pubkey
OP_0 OP_PUSHBYTES_20 39ad33a2d38a67891e4117a4b78ee653e6a6f4da
address
bc1q8xkn8gkn3fncj8jpz7jt0rhx20n2dax6aqmww6
transaction
d53ffcb6b461f59892c60c23afdc62516116fa0626eae377ceba910ac326f47b
spent
true